#50b98d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50b98d is composed of 31.4% red, 72.5%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.8%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 154.9 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 52%. #50b98d color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00731b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#50b98d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030705 is the darkest color, while #f8f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#50b98d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f8a85 is the less saturated color, while #0efb98 is the most saturated one.
